e8caf52747238f3f4044ddd6949b7d0a8a3fc2ff35954777ee76dfc140f24f16

1745493 (30344 blocks ago)

⏴ Block 1745492 (2c07f6d2…3df) | Block 1745494 ⏵ | Latest block ⏭

Metadata

23/12/2024, 23:08 UTC (42d 3:29:08 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details